    TUZ was delisted on the 11th of December, 2019.
32 hedge funds and large institutions have $80.2M invested in PIMCO 1-3 Year U.S. Treasury Index Exchange-Traded Fund in 2015 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 4 funds opening new positions, 12 increasing their positions, 10 reducing their positions, and 3 closing their positions.
